Our Parks division received our new state-of-the-art Laser Grade ABI machine today, thanks to a generous grant from the CCSD#1 Recreation Board. Our crew spent the day learning how to use this machine to its fullest extent. The grader is vital to maintain all the hard work put into the baseball fields over the past years to keep the fields level and safe for play. Thanks to CCSD#1 Recreation Board for their ongoing support of the baseball programs in Rawlins!
Multiple CCSD#1 grants, private grants, volunteer hours, and City of Rawlins staff time have been dedicated to revitalizing the baseball fields at both the VFW Fields and the Sports Complex. This has included laser grading and new turf for infields, grading and reseeding of the outfields, and new scoreboards.
